the city of angels? a massive brawl erupts in the crowds at a los angeles chargers - rams game as fans throw punches and drink - leaving one with a bloody black eye
A fight broke out between NFL fans of the Los Angeles crosstown rivals during a Chargers and Rams game on Saturday night.
Two fans were going back and forth at each other during the second quarter when one Rams fan, wearing an Aaron Donald jersey, had a beer thrown at him by woman while his back was turned.
The man wearing the Donald jersey turned around and began throwing punches to the other fans in front of him.
Three or four fans, who appeared to be in the same group, teamed up and started attacking the fan with the Donald jersey who was left with blood dripping down his face.

The fight lasted for 'well over 5 minutes' according to Mike Kijanski, who was at the game sitting two sections over from the brawl in the lower level. The man wearing the Donald jersey was eventually escorted out by security.
Another fight between two fans broke out, which left one man's face bleeding.
It's unclear what exactly sparked the argument and whether there were any arrests. Several videos of the brawl have been circulating on Twitter.
The beat downs took place as fans returned to SoFi Stadium in Inglewood since the pandemic. The Chargers won 13-6 the Week 1 preseason game. The preseason game was expected to give players in the reserves a chance to hit the field.

'We'll get a chance to see a lot of our depth guys, because there's going to be probably about 35 players that are not playing in this game for us,' said Rams coach Sean McVay, who later explained that 'a lot of those guys would be playing, but they're actually injured and we're forced to hold them out as precautionary reasons.'
Bryce Perkins and Devlin Hodges were put in as quarterback. Perkins signed with the Rams as an undrafted free agent in 2020 coming out of his college career at Virginia. He spent most of the 2020 season on the practice squad. While he was on the active roster for the final regular season game and divisional playoff game against Green Bay, he did not play.
Perkins is the nephew of Don Perkins, a six-time Pro Bowl selection who played for the Dallas Cowboys from 1961-68.
Hodges signed with the Pittsburgh Steelers as an undrafted free agent in 2019 coming from Samford University. He started six games for the Pittsburgh Steelers in 2019 when Ben Roethlisberger and Mason Rudolph were injured.
Hodges spent the 2020 season on the Steelers' practice squad and signed with the Rams in January.
Chargers coach Brandon Staley said 'Our plan is the players that we need to evaluate on our team are going to play in that game. Some of our starters are going to play in that game because we need to evaluate them,' according to NBC 4.
